By Scott Gilfoid: At the LA press conference to promote their December 11th fight at the Mandalay Bay Resort and Casino in Las Vegas, Nevada, World Boxing Association (WBA) light welterweight interim champion Marcos Maidana (29-1, 27 KO’s) looks powerful, like a little bull. He looks like he’s ready to tear WBA light welterweight champion Amir Khan’s head off right now two months before the fight. Maidana had his game face on for the press conference and seemed like he wanted to tear into Khan right then and there. There isn’t much of a height advantage for Khan in this and that’s going to be a problem for Khan. He usually dwarfs his opponents, but that’s not going to be the case with Maidana. Without a height advantage, Khan is going to be getting royally tagged by Maidana in this fight. With a chin as delicate as Khan’s, I don’t see him being able to take more two or three rounds of hard shots from Maidana without crumbling and getting knocked out.
